Key Roles:
- Greeting customers and helping them with orders.
- Knowing where stock is located.
- Assisting team members to complete tasks.
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Using the VIN number, locate the correct part needed in an efficient manner. Quote and order or pull available parts.
- Assure the correct account number is used for shipping to the customer and billing.
- Complete all warranty information and credit cores when needed.
- Keep the work area clean, and organized and displays stocked.
